About Christopher A. Pohl
Christopher A. Pohl is a scholar working on Spectroscopy, Biomedical Engineering, Molecular Biology, Analytical Chemistry and Bioengineering, having authored 127 papers that have together received 4.7k indexed citations. Recurring topics across this work include Analytical Chemistry and Chromatography (83 papers), Microfluidic and Capillary Electrophoresis Applications (39 papers), Analytical Chemistry and Sensors (18 papers), Chromatography in Natural Products (16 papers), Protein purification and stability (15 papers), Analytical chemistry methods development (14 papers), Mass Spectrometry Techniques and Applications (14 papers) and Computational Drug Discovery Methods (12 papers). The work is most often cited by research in Spectroscopy (2.3k citations), Analytical Chemistry (1.2k citations), Bioengineering (370 citations), Health, Toxicology and Mutagenesis (542 citations) and Biomedical Engineering (1.5k citations). Christopher A. Pohl has collaborated with scholars based in United States, Australia and United Kingdom. Frequent co-authors include Nebojša Avdalović, Roy D. Rocklin, Brian A. Jones, B. E. Richter, John L. Ezzell, Nathan L. Porter, Paul R. Haddad, John Stillian, Rosanne W. Slingsby and Roman Szücs. Their work appears in journals such as Journal of Chromatography A, Analytical Chemistry, Analytical Biochemistry, Journal of Separation Science and Talanta.
